Ikan, also referred to as fish, are a various group of aquatic animals which are located in an array of habitats around the globe. They're A necessary Component of the ecosystem, taking part in an important function in protecting the stability of aquatic environments. There are about 33,000 species of fish, creating them probably the most assorted group of vertebrates on the planet. From little guppies to huge whale sharks, fish can be found in all shapes and sizes, with lots of adaptations that make it possible for them to thrive in numerous environments. Whether or not they are now living in freshwater rivers and lakes, brackish estuaries, or even the salty depths on the ocean, fish are an integral part of the organic earth.
Habitat and Distribution of Ikan
Fish are available in almost every aquatic surroundings in the world, within the freezing waters of the Arctic to the warm, tropical seas from the equator. They inhabit freshwater rivers and lakes, and also saltwater oceans and seas. Some species of fish are even ready to outlive in brackish h2o, where by freshwater and saltwater mix. The distribution of fish is influenced by several different factors, like temperature, water high quality, and foods availability. Some species are hugely specialized and may only be present in certain habitats, while others are more adaptable and can prosper in a variety of environments. The range of fish habitats is often a testomony to their capability to adapt and survive in various disorders.
Actual physical Properties of Ikan
Fish are available lots of designs, sizes, and colours, with adaptations that make it possible for them to thrive in their specific environments. They may have streamlined bodies that are very well-suited for swimming, with fins that help them maneuver in the drinking water without difficulty. Many species of fish have scales that deliver defense from predators and assist control their human body temperature. Some fish have specialized adaptations for respiratory, including gills that allow them to extract oxygen within the drinking water. Others have formulated special sensory organs, such as lateral traces that help them detect movement and vibrations in the drinking water. The physical features of fish are extremely assorted, reflecting the wide range of environments where they live.
Habits and Diet of Ikan
Fish exhibit a variety of behaviors, from solitary hunters to schooling species that journey in significant groups. Some fish are territorial and can protect their territory from intruders, while others tend to be more social and may type intricate social hierarchies within their groups. Fish have a diverse food plan that includes every little thing from algae and plankton to other fish and invertebrates. Some species are specialised feeders, with one of a kind adaptations for capturing their prey, while others are opportunistic feeders that may try to eat whatever is obtainable. The habits and eating plan of fish are intently tied for their specific habitat and ecological market, with Every single species actively playing a novel job in the ecosystem.

Conservation Endeavours for Ikan
Several species of fish are facing threats from habitat destruction, overfishing, air pollution, and climate adjust. Consequently, you will discover many conservation initiatives geared toward shielding fish populations and their habitats. These attempts incorporate establishing marine secured areas the place fishing is limited, implementing sustainable fishing methods, and cutting down air pollution from agricultural runoff and industrial sources. Moreover, there are actually ongoing study initiatives to raised understand the biology and ecology of fish species, along with initiatives to boost recognition about the necessity of fish conservation among the general public. By Functioning jointly to safeguard fish as well as their habitats, we can easily ensure that these essential animals proceed to thrive for generations to come.
